Home People Malese Jow Malese Jow shows Malese Jow shows Malese Jow TV Shows (15) The Shannara Chronicles (2016) As Mareth, She was 24 years old The Flash (2014) As Dr. Light, She was 23 years old The Flash (2014) As Linda Park, She was 23 years old Star-Crossed (2014) As Julia, She was 22 years old Big Time Rush (2009) As Lucy Stone, She was 18 years old NCIS: Los Angeles (2009) As Jennifer Kim, She was 18 years old The Troop (2009) As Cadence Nash, She was 18 years old The Vampire Diaries (2009) As Anna Zhu, She was 18 years old Castle (2009) As Hillary Cooper, She was 18 years old The Secret Life of the American Teenager (2008) As Gail, She was 17 years old Wizards of Waverly Place (2007) As Ruby Donahue, She was 16 years old iCarly (2007) As Fake Carly, She was 16 years old Hannah Montana (2006) As Rachel, She was 15 years old Desperate Housewives (2004) As Violet, She was 13 years old Unfabulous (2004) As Geena Fabiano, She was 13 years old